JD(U) stages dharna against the Centre's anti-people policy
Kolkata, Aug 9 (UNI) State Janata Dal(United) activists organised a day-long-dharna in protest against the Centre and state government's anti-people policies and mark the 65th anniversary of Quit India Movement Day today.
Addressing a rally here, JD(U) general secretary Ashoke Das criticised the UPA government's silence over Israel's bombing on Lebanon and demanded that the United Nations should step in immediately to prevent the Israel-US axis from destroying the sovereignty of Lebanon.
Mr Das also charged the Congress-led UPA government at the Centre for obeying US diktats by remaining mum on Israel's actions.
The UPA government should withdraw from the nuclear deal with the US, he demanded.
''We also protest the state government's decision to acquire agricultural land for industries, which would create rapid unemployment in the state,'' Mr Das added.
